Page 18 text:

TRUE’25 BLUE GUY ALEXANDER ALEX Commercial Course Football 2-3-4; Track 3; Boys' Club 3-4. Mixes reason with pleasure and reason until mirth. MILLARD T. ANDERSON “MILL General Course Boys' Club 3; Football 3-4. “Because he doesn't talk is no sign he hasn't anything to say ELOIS BAHNEMAN “BONNIE Commercial Course True Blue 4. “She is mischievous, but oh, so innocent. GRACE VIRGINIA BENZ “BEN General Course Class Basketball 2-3-4; Class Colley Ball 2-3-4; Clarence 3; Operetta 3-4; Class Stunt 2-3; C. A. C. 2-3-4; Student Council 4; Glee Club 2-3-4; True Blue Staff 4; Declama- tory 1; Hiking Club 2. “I work when I work, and play when I play. Mostly work. MALCOLM BUSH “JAKE General Course Boys’ Club 3-4; Vice Presi- dent 4; Debate 4. “Principle is ever my motto, not expediency.”

Page 19 text:

CURTIS CHRYST “GRID General Course Foothill 1-2-3-4; Football Captain 4; Basket ball 3-4; Track 3; Class Basketball 1-2 3-4; Class President 1; Lite- rary Club 4; Student Council 1-4; Boys' Club 3-4; Debate 4 “Virile in strength and strong in athletics, but oh so bash- ful. WARD C. COOK COOKIE” Commercial Course Commercial Contest 3. “He who hesitates is lost. WILLIAM COULTER “BILL General Course Football 4; Class Basketball 3 Class Stunt 3; Literary Club 4; Boys’ Club 4; Debate 4. “Gee! but I'm glad I’m free No wedding bells for me. ALLEN COVELL '•COV” General Course Operetta 4; Boys’ Club 3-4; Literary Club 4; President Literary Club 4; Camera Club 1; Clee Club 4: Student Coun- cil 4; Debate 4. “He talked an infinite deal of nothing.” RALEIGH DAHL “DOLL. General Course “Success is but for the am- bitious.”
